Inserm Research Facility Directors’ Day in Nouvelle-Aquitaine

In early April, the Inserm Nouvelle-Aquitaine regional delegation organized the Research Unit Directors’ Day, bringing together the heads of research units, departments, and CICs in the region for a session of discussion and reflection on current issues in biomedical research.

 

The CRIBL unit participated in this event, represented by its director, Eric Pinaud. This meeting, focused on fostering dialogue between the research units and the delegation, helped strengthen ties among regional stakeholders and provided an opportunity to share common challenges and the solutions being implemented.

 

Following an introduction by Richard Salives, Inserm’s regional representative, the morning was devoted to a presentation of the delegation’s services and several current topics: psychosocial risk management, cybersecurity, management tools, and challenges encountered with SIFAC+.

 

The afternoon featured inspiring discussions on digital technology and artificial intelligence with Hugues Berry, head of Inserm’s AI & Digital Division, followed by a discussion on clinical research with Jean-Jacques Kiladjian, who presented the Clinical Research Division and spoke about the future Department of Clinical Research & Investigation.
